    Okay, now you know that folks are going to look in here and wonder that this is about.

    So, here is the thread from last year of how we all dealt with AngelofCaines illness, and then, finally, his death.

    http://co-forum.perfectworld.com/showthread.php?t=217141

    And here is the video made on the night of his Memorial organized by and participated by so many of COs heroes.

    Angel of Caines - Memorial

    That odd beginning, with everyone carrying objects and heading over to the Westside was prearranged because it was one of the things AoC loved to do. Apparently he loved coming into the RenCen with a heavy object and like a pied piper he would then gather many other heroes by proding them to pick up any object and follow him down to the Westside for a impromptu "Westside - Take out the Trash Day."

    So after that beginning of the Memorial and the reliving that memory, everyone seemed to just gather up and go on a Cosmic hunt. It seemed pretty cathartic at the time.

    I didn't know AoC. I don't mean not just as a friend. I doubt I even saw his characters in CO. But I know how the loss feels.

    I used to play on a Neverwinter Nights server that was run like a small MMO (heh, very small considering max people logged in could only be like 40). It was a good community of friends, gathered either in the game, on IRC, or posting on the forums. There was one player/DM that we all joked was our "D&D Supercomputer" on account of his being able to recite just about any rule for the game. He wasn't a "rules lawyer" though, it's just that he cared a lot for the game and fairness and just had a damn good memory for the various rules. He came up with some great plots as a DM, had some memorable PCs, and was a great guy OOC too.

    He passed away quite suddenly and unexpectedly. One of the other players was close friends with him and broke the news to the rest of us. It was the first time our NWN community lost a member.

    It's odd in a way. I never met the guy in real life. Most of us never met him. Few of us even knew his real name or vice versa. Yet we could all feel a loss, a void where he was. A lot of us gathered on IRC to mourn his passing and share stories about times with him. Never was it more obvious how much of a community we were.

    We had additional players pass away over the years, from various causes. Each time we came together as a community to mourn and heal.


    A friend online is no less a friend. May the memories of those we lost keep alive in our hearts.
